JohnFTitor
Wazoku Software Developer | Django | JavaScript | React | Redux | Ruby on Rails | Test Driven Development Advocate | Hobbyist Writer | Professional Learner
@Wazoku Manizales, Colombia
Pinned Repositories
choose-your-pokemon
The complete website for pokefans to pick the best pokemon. This capstone project was built using JavaScript, bundled using webpack and tested using jest.
RentUrTechBackend
This is a Ruby on Rails API part of a full-stack project called "RentUrTech" (check the link to the front-end below). The main goal of this project is to provide users with an environment to reserve a specific product for a set amount of time. Thus, in this application users can create an account, can get an authorization token, and can retrieve all or one piece of equipment. They will be required to have an authorization token to manage their own reservations. For creating and destroying equipment, the user needs a proper role. Feel free to take this project and modify it for your own business use!
anime-list
This website was built using React and Redux. The main objective was to fetch data from an external API using the thunk middleware within the redux store, holding different states for each part of the app and filtering data based on user parameters.
capstoneProject_first
This is a simple landing page built using HTML/SCSS and JavaScript. This page provides basic navigation functionality and was made using an appropriate SCSS file structure.
leaderBoard
This website is a Leader Board App list using the Leaderboard API and JavaScript async and await functionality. It allows the user to submit scores and retrieve data of previously saved scores from a private game created the first time the page is opened. Have fun!
my_blog_app
This is a basic Blog website that allows users to create, edit, comment and delete posts, keeping data in a database. This project implements both authorization and authentication in order to provide extended functionality to logged in and authorized users.
personal-portfolio
This is is a personal project aimed to build a much more personal and professional portfolio, which I designed myself. Additionally, my plan is to use this project to learn about Material UI library and Tailwind CSS project.
space-travelers-hub
This is a React-Redux based project, built with pair programming and gitflow, following this kanban workflow. The page have a global state that holds the Rockets and missions from the spaceX API, and allow you to reserve them, displaying on your profile section the missions that you own.
spendless
Spendless is a Ruby on Rails application that allows users to keep track of their expenses and categories. Manage your own money, manage your own life
toDoList
In this project, I built a simple HTML list of To-Do tasks. This simple web page was built using Webpack, creating everything from a JavaScript index file that imported all the modules and assets
JohnFTitor's Repositories
JohnFTitor/anime-list
This website was built using React and Redux. The main objective was to fetch data from an external API using the thunk middleware within the redux store, holding different states for each part of the app and filtering data based on user parameters.
JohnFTitor/capstoneProject_first
This is a simple landing page built using HTML/SCSS and JavaScript. This page provides basic navigation functionality and was made using an appropriate SCSS file structure.
JohnFTitor/my_blog_app
This is a basic Blog website that allows users to create, edit, comment and delete posts, keeping data in a database. This project implements both authorization and authentication in order to provide extended functionality to logged in and authorized users.
JohnFTitor/personal-portfolio
This is is a personal project aimed to build a much more personal and professional portfolio, which I designed myself. Additionally, my plan is to use this project to learn about Material UI library and Tailwind CSS project.
JohnFTitor/catalog-of-stuff
Ruby Capstone Project meant to wrap the concepts of Ruby language and SQL Databases, creating a OOP project based on an UML diagram. In this project, we created a console app that will help us to keep a record of different types of things we won: books, music albums, and games.
JohnFTitor/opp_school_library
Ruby library project that runs in the command line. Meant to understand the base principles of OPP programming while building an application with a new programming paradigm
JohnFTitor/spendless
Spendless is a Ruby on Rails application that allows users to keep track of their expenses and categories. Manage your own money, manage your own life
JohnFTitor/my_recipe_app
This is a simple Ruby On Rails project. Recipe app that allows user to create, delete, and read recipes created by them or the community, allowing the users to decide whether they'd be public or not. Additionally, it allows users to create food records and generate a shopping list based on the missing food for their recipes. It comes with authentication and authorization functionality.
JohnFTitor/JohnFTitor
My personal Repository
JohnFTitor/hellorails
Basic repo to understand new rails Project command
JohnFTitor/morse-code
Simple decoder for Morse messages.
JohnFTitor/coding_challenges
A repo to store solutions for coding challenges
JohnFTitor/personal-portfolio-API
This is an API meant to hold all the data for my Portfolio regarding each project I've made. This includes methods for Storing, Deleting and Getting projects. The main goal with this is to facilitate the way I add new projects, separating the front-end logic with the data
JohnFTitor/bookGrocerBlake
Learning React Native First Project
JohnFTitor/djangoBlogApp
Just a basic Django blog app project
JohnFTitor/first-contributions
🚀✨ Help beginners to contribute to open source projects
JohnFTitor/hello-rails-react
Testing rails with react in one app
JohnFTitor/hello-react-front-end
Simple React Frontend for the Rails API project
JohnFTitor/histogram
This application allows users to generate histograms based on user input or a text file
JohnFTitor/learningC
This repo contains generally small pieces of code, with the only goal of learning the C programming language
JohnFTitor/personalPortfolioAngular
An Angular version of my previous porfolio
JohnFTitor/TDD
A repo meant to understand TDD in Ruby using Rspec
JohnFTitor/alexandria
Alexandria is a website that allows users to buy books online, having different options for filtering, checking details, adding to cart, and buying books
JohnFTitor/blog-app-api-practice
JohnFTitor/django-blog-app
This website allows users to manage their own content, publishing posts, interacting through comments and likes, and following other users to receive alerts on their posting activity
JohnFTitor/first-django-app
First Django app following official Django documentation
JohnFTitor/hello-rails-back-end
A simple hello world API
JohnFTitor/portfolio-API
Django API for my Personal Portfolio, to store information regarding projects and also blog updates
JohnFTitor/tourOfHeroes
Angular tutorial
JohnFTitor/understanding-angular
This repo is meant to follow Angular's documentation to understand the basic features of Angular